Clearwater FAQ

Can I park on Clearwater residential streets overnight?

Standard passenger vehicles may park on residential streets unless signed otherwise; oversized, commercial, and recreational vehicles are prohibited on residential rights-of-way.

What state law backs Clearwater's parking enforcement?

Florida Statute 316.1945 authorizes stopping, standing, and parking enforcement and towing, and Chapter 316 governs general motor vehicle and traffic rules statewide.

Tarpon Springs FAQ

Can I park on the street in front of my Tarpon Springs house?

Yes for ordinary passenger vehicles, subject to width limits and any posted restrictions. Trailers wider than 96 inches and detached trailers are banned in residential rights-of-way.

Are there metered parking zones in Tarpon Springs?

Yes. The Sponge Docks and downtown commercial areas have signed and metered spaces with posted time limits enforced by Tarpon Springs Police.
